Sunday was spent going on our private ATV tour with Rancho San Cristobal. Honestly we all preferred this tour over Cactus Tours just because it was more inexpensive compared to Cactus Tours. Rancho also was more personal since it was more private with just us four being on the tour while on Cactus, we were with a group.


During the tour, we each got our individual ATV in which we all followed our guide tour, Brenda, who was super sweet and attentive to our needs. We followed a trail through the desert which then leaded to a private beach riding through the beach's dirt domes to then having our own private beach photo shoot. 😍😍
